Expand Down Expand Up @@ -1184,6 +1196,18 @@ mod test {
test_same("x = g() & x");

test_same("x = (x -= 2) ^ x");

// GetValue(x) has no sideeffect when x is a resolved identifier
test("var x; x.y = x.y + 3", "var x; x.y += 3");
test("var x; x.#y = x.#y + 3", "var x; x.#y += 3");
test_same("x.y = x.y + 3");
// this can be compressed if `y` does not have side effect
test_same("var x; x[y] = x[y] + 3");
// GetValue(x) has a side effect in this case
// Example case: `var a = { get b() { console.log('b'); return { get c() { console.log('c') } } } }; a.b.c = a.b.c + 1`
test_same("var x; x.y.z = x.y.z + 3");
// This case is not supported, since the minifier does not support with statements
// test_same("var x; with (z) { x.y || (x.y = 3) }");
}
